Transaction 585392e62dfcaee4654f9769cb6fbe3d3063c4ca3e7241f54559687a2cf8083f

1 Input
2 Outputs
  • 585392e62dfcaee4654f9769cb6fbe3d3063c4ca3e7241f54559687a2cf8083f:0
  • value  1208095290
    address  1FcGVibiL17Q9wjP1usrmfXT4W4u1QfYhY
  • 585392e62dfcaee4654f9769cb6fbe3d3063c4ca3e7241f54559687a2cf8083f:1
  • value  95973040
    address  381FprjyjEHhDWs9KHsYJd9pTguUHMHEJv